About Itworld.com
ITworld is an online web-based platform that enables IT influencers to share information with each other. It helps its users by providing tools to share and contribute content, new ways to connect with other IT professionals, and contribute their knowledge back to the community. ITworld was launched in Framingham, Massachusetts.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Framingham?

Understanding the cost of living near Framingham is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Itworld.com.
Framingham's Cost of Living Index is approximately 125.7 (25.7% more expensive than US average; 5.2% less than MA average). MetroWest hub, housing costs above US avg. MWRTA bus, Commuter Rail. When planning your budget based on a salary from Itworld.com,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,800 - $2,600+ A significant portion of Itworld.com sal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$180 - $290 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$50 (MWRT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$460 - $680 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$430 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$410 - $760+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,330 - $5,080+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
